The Legal Grey Area of Research Chemicals
The more info landscape surrounding research chemicals exists within a complex regulatory grey zone. Often marketed as "not for human ingestion," these substances frequently appear shortly after existing laws are passed, exploiting loopholes and shifting definitions to avoid outright prohibition. Manufacturers and sellers can operate in this vacuum by claiming the items are intended solely for academic study or forensic examination, creating a challenging situation for authorities attempting to control their availability. This ongoing “cat and mouse” between legislation and innovation results in a constantly changing legal status, leaving consumers and law enforcement alike in a state of doubt.
